Concrete Foundation Repair in Charlotte, NC
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the structural integ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ically involve assessing and fixing problems such as cracks, uneven settling, bowing walls, and shifting slabs. Projects can range from stabilizing a cracked basement wall to leveling a sunken porch or driveway, ensuring the stability and safety of the entire property. Homeowners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s like doors or windows that stick, uneven floors, or visible cracks in the foundation or walls, as these may indicate underlying issues that require professional attention.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the problem, the methods used for repair, and the potential impact on their home’s structure. It’s important to consider factors such as the age of the foundation, soil conditions, and the extent of damage to determine the most appropriate solutions. Clear communication about the process can help homeowners make informed decisions about preserving the stability and value of their property over time.

Common Concrete Foundation Repair Jobs
Crack Repair - addressing foundation c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Settlement Stabilization - leveling uneven concrete slabs caused by soil shifting or erosion.
Pier and Beam Support - reinforcing or replacing supports to improve foundation stability.
Basement Wall Repair - fixing bowing or cracked basement walls to prevent water intrusion and collapse.
Mudjacking - lifting and stabilizing sunken concrete surfaces with a slurry injection process.
Drainage Solutions - improving water runoff around the foundation to reduce soil movement and moisture issues.
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ate a need for foundation repair?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ick can signal foundation issues.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Soil movement, poor drainage, and moisture fluctuations are common causes of foundation shifting or settling.
What types of foundation repair are available?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and stabilization to restore structural integrity.
How can foundation issues affect property value? Unaddressed foundation problems can reduce property value and complicate resale efforts.
